The Sun is primarily composed of hydrogen (74% by mass) and helium (24%). These two elements make up more than 98% of the Sun's total mass. Other elements like oxygen, carbon, neon, and iron make up the remaining portion in smaller quantities.

The Sun is primarily composed of hydrogen and helium, which make up about 74% and 24% of its mass, respectively. The remaining 2% consists of heavier elements such as oxygen, carbon, neon, and iron. These proportions can vary slightly, but hydrogen and helium dominate the solar composition.
